Chivas USA 2, FC Dallas 0
GAME 2 – March 29, 2009
FC DALLAS 0, CHIVAS USA 2
Pizza Hut Park – Frisco, Texas
Scoring:
CHV -- Eduardo Lillingston 1 (Gerson Mayen 1) 56
CHV -- Bojan Stepanovic 1 (unassisted) 75
FC DALLAS: Ray Burse, Drew Moor, Steve Purdy, Daniel Torres, Blake Wagner (Aaron Pitchkolan 46), Dax McCarty (Andre Rocha 65), Pablo Ricchetti, David Ferreira, Dave van den Bergh, Jeff Cunningham (Peri Marosevic 80), Kenny Cooper.
Subs Not Used: Josh Lambo, Brek Shea, Bruno Guarda, Eric Avila.
Shots – 13; Shots on Goal – 6; Total Saves – 1; Fouls – 13; Offsides – 4; Corner Kicks – 5
CHIVAS USA: Zach Thornton, Mariano Trujillo, Carey Talley, Shavar Thomas, Jonathan Bornstein, Atiba Harris, Jesse Marsch, Paulo Nagamura, Gerson Mayen (Jorge Flores 82), Justin Braun, Eduardo Lillingston (Bojan Stepanovic 69).
Subs Not Used: Lance Parker, Jim Curtin, Maykel Galindo, Michael Lahoud.
Shots – 8; Shots on Goal – 3; Total Saves – 6; Fouls – 13; Offsides – 5; Corner Kicks – 3
Misconduct Summary:
DAL -- Aaron Pitchkolan (caution) 68
CHV -- Mariano Trujillo (caution) 70
NOTES:
· FC Dallas is now 6-4-4 all-time against Chivas USA and 3-2-3 at home.
· The loss ends a four-game Dallas unbeaten streak against Chivas.
· FCD and Chivas USA will conclude the 2009 two-game series one month from now, when the teams face off at The Home Depot Center on Saturday, April 25.
· Dallas is now winless in its last six games dating back to the 2008 season. The team’s last win came on Sept. 28, 2008 versus DC United.
· Team captain Pablo Ricchetti returned to the starting lineup after sitting out the season-opener due to a two-game suspension dating back to last year.
· Ray Burse today got his first start of the season in goal, the ninth start of his career. Burse started two games last year with the last coming on June 6, 2008 at New England.
· Defender Aaron Pitchkolan also made his first appearance of the season as a halftime substitute after missing last week’s game with a red card suspension.
· Rookie forward Peri Marosevic made his Major League Soccer debut in the 80th minute, replacing Jeff Cunningham.
· Goalkeeper Dario Sala missed the game after undergoing surgery on Tuesday to remove part of a torn meniscus in his left knee. Defender Marcelo Saragosa missed his second straight match after undergoing the same surgery on his right knee in early March.
· Today’s attendance was 6,524.
· A full recap can be found at www.FCDallas.com .
· FC Dallas will play its first away game of the season next Saturday, April 4 when the team visits the New England Revolution at Gillette Stadium (6:30 p.m. CT live on KFWD-52).
· Head Coach Schellas Hyndman on the game: “(It was) a frustrating game. Disappointing, but I think the first half we created enough opportunities to score a goal. Second half, we were supposed to come out and play a little bit harder, try to take the game to them, and we make a mistake, and all I see is the ball in the back of the net. Just a very frustrating, disappointing result. I think we’re a better team than what we showed.”
